The minimum age requirement for getting a commercial pilot license is 18 years. After completion of 18 years and graduation in physics or a related field, you can go for pilot training and after the training and completing 200 to 500 flying hours, license can be issued.

There are many career opportunities for BA Economics graduates. First of all BA Economics graduates are eligible for all government jobs in central and state government where eligibility criteria is graduation degree. You can evaluate Civil Services, PSC in state, SSC etc. Indian Economic Services is one of the coveted jobs for Economics graduate. Reserve Bank of India also hires Economics graduates. Lot of PSUs and public sector banks hires economics graduate for both officer and clerical roles. Economics is a social science concerned with the production, distribution and consumption of goods and services. It studies how individuals, businesses, governments and nations make choices on allocating resources to satisfy their wants and needs, and tries to determine how these groups should organize and coordinate efforts to achieve maximum output. Economics can generally be broken down into macroeconomics, which concentrates on the behaviour of the aggregate economy, and microeconomics, which focuses on individual consumers. Hello Nazia,
As of now, you are not eligible for an MBA in USA. Firstly, you haven't completed your Bachelor's degree, secondly you must gain work experience on completion of your degree and prior to the MBA application process. Additionally, you must take GMAT, thirdly your IELTS I am afraid is slightly low, but it can still be considered depending on the university. If you are keen for a management degree, you may consider MS Management instead. Also, keep note that most US universities require a four year Bachelor's degree.
